Digital Storm: Fresh Business Strategies from the Electronic Marketplace

Rate this book
Digital Storm is not about the internet. It is about doing business in the new century. In 1999 Lou Gerstner, Chief Executive of IBM, "The dot.coms are only the fireflies before the storm." While much has been written about the fireflies, the current book focuses on the storm. More specifically, it provides insights to help companies sail through the digital storm, while exposing shortcomings in past and present concepts.

Leading companies are still licking their wounds from the early turbulences of the digital storm and unable to comprehend the ensuing lull. This book will help them to fully grasp the underlying forces that are re-shaping the way business is done.
